Fever is an innate response to cellular injury and is initiated when pyrogens are released from damaged cells or certain bacteria.


Definitions:

Many-trait Approach

A method in personality psychology that examines the relationship between a wide array of traits and a specific behavior or outcome, aiming to understand personality as a complex interplay of many traits.

Typological Approach

A method of categorization based on discrete types or categories, often used in personality psychology to organize personality traits.

Factor Analyses

A statistical technique designed to discover the latent factors responsible for the observed correlation patterns among a set of variables.

Correlation Matrices

A table showing correlation coefficients between sets of variables, revealing how changes in one variable are associated with changes in another.
